Where to Use This Design Asset with Caution

No graphic design asset works everywhere, and Jesus Touch Water Svg has its limitations. I would avoid using it in formal corporate branding where the tone needs to feel direct, structured, or data-driven. The organic, flowing nature of the design can clash with rigid layouts or dense information hierarchies. It also struggles in small mobile graphics where fine details may become lost or muddy. If you are designing text-heavy ads or thumbnails where the asset competes with the main message, it is better to leave it out or reduce its opacity significantly. Low-contrast backgrounds can also diminish the impact of the design, especially if you are placing it over pastels or light grays. Overly minimal brands that rely on stark white space and tight typography may find the asset too decorative for their visual language. In those cases, the design can feel like an intrusion rather than an enhancement. Finally, if you are working with T-Shirt Designs that need to be printed in one color or on dark fabrics, test the SVG in black and white first. Some of the subtle flow may be lost in single-color screen printing. Always preview it on real mockups before committing.

Practical Brand Designer Notes Before You Download

Before you add Jesus Touch Water Svg to your creative design toolkit, run through a few checks. First, test it against your brand color palette. The asset should harmonize with your primary and secondary hues, not fight them. Second, check how it reads in black and white. A strong SVG design maintains its visual integrity even without color. Third, place it inside real campaign mockups. Do not judge it in isolation. See how it interacts with your logo, your typography, and your product imagery. Fourth, preview it on mobile screens. If the details blur or the composition feels unbalanced at small sizes, consider using it only in larger formats. Fifth, test readability when pairing it with different font styles. I found that Jesus Touch Water Svg pairs well with clean sans serif fonts for a modern feel, but it can also work with script fonts or handwritten fonts if you want a more organic look. Serif fonts add a touch of editorial elegance, while display fonts should be used sparingly to avoid visual noise. Sixth, review the spacing and balance around the asset. It needs breathing room. Finally, confirm the commercial license before using it in paid campaigns, client work, or business branding. A proper commercial design license protects you and your clients legally. That step is non-negotiable for any serious designer or content creator.
